Jasper McDonald-Fleming is a husband, father, son, and a true believer in fighting for what is right. He earned his bachelor’s degree from Elizabeth City State University and a Master’s in Human Development & Family Studies from North Carolina Central University. He is the husband to Leondis and the father to their loving and beautiful daughter who attends Durham Public School. Currently, Jasper works as a Financial Analyst at UNC REX Healthcare and has over 10+ years of professional financial experience. Jasper is also, a member of the Delta Zeta Sigma chapter of Phi Beta Sigma Fraternity, Inc of Durham.  

Jasper has always had a passion to service to his community and a willingness to help others. It was during Jasper’s senior year of high school that he knew he wanted to make a change. Jasper worked alongside other students to make changes for a better tomorrow for their hometown of Roanoke Rapids, NC. He continued his advocacy work at Elizabeth City State University by working with other community organizations to give back the community and fight for many cause such as social justice and voting rights.

When elected to Durham Schools Board, Jasper will work very close with the Superintendent, The County Commissioners and the Durham Community to ensure that we build a better school system to equip our students with the necessary tools to succeed in today’s world. In addition, he will fight to make sure that DPS has equitable pay for ALL to guarantee that DPS is marketable and retains the talented, dedicated, and committed educational professionals of Durham Public Schools. Lastly, he will build transparency with the community and stakeholders.

COVID

  • Creating clear expectations and plan for safely addressing current COVID pandemic

  • Collaborating with schools to address opportunity gap widened by the impact of COVID

Equitable pay

  • Median income for Durham County is $35,390

  • Average cost of rent for Durham County $1,432 ($17,184 a year)

  • Current teacher pay does not allow for a livable wage.

  • Essential employees – school staff

    • Collaboration between school board and schools to create equitable and livable wage for employees of DPS
